WebThe IHSS program provides payment for non-medical in-home care for qualified individuals who are unable to remain safely in their homes without this assistance. The applicant must be 65 years or older, blind, and/or be a disabled child or adult. IHSS includes a wide range of services for those who qualify. Protective supervision is an IHSS service for people who, due to a mental impairment or mental illness, need to be observed 24 hours per day to protect them from injuries, hazards, or accidents. IHSS payments to live-in providers are excluded from 'gross income' according to IRS Bulletin 2014-7 and Internal Revenue Code Section 131. Gross income is the starting point for determining adjusted gross income or 'AGI'. 'MAGI' is a term Medicaid uses that starts with AGI.
